Abstract

The utility model relates to a geologic survey technical field, concretely relates to portable geological compass. This portable geological compass hinges the upper cover of covering under to be covered on, and is equipped with reflector and short sight vane, and lower cover upper portion is equipped with the calibrated scale, and the calibrated scale is equipped with the compass needle among them, and compass needle one side is equipped with circular level respectively, and the lower cover has a long sight vane through the hinge is articulated. Compass needle one side is equipped with the goniometer, compass needle and calibrated scale surface are equipped with one deck self luminescent material layer, the damping rubber sleeve has been cup jointed to lower cover bottom outside matching, under cover and be equipped with magnetic declination adjusting screw. The problem of the big and function singleness of geological compass's measuring error and convenient and practical are solved among the prior art to this geological compass dependable performance. When night or peripheral not enough light, give off light in the surperficial self luminescent material layer of compass needle and calibrated scale, and help geology personnel see the reading clearly. The compass needle adopts the liquid damping structure, this liquid damping structure, and antimagnetic interference, measuring error is little.

Description

A kind of portable circumferentor
Technical field
This utility model relates to geological exploration technical field, is specifically related to a kind of portable circumferentor.
Background technology
Compass is one of geologist's " three treasured " (geologic hammer, compass and magnifier), is also ground One of basic tool of matter work, circumferentor is the indispensable instrument of field geological work, can be used for surveying Measure the occurrence of rock mass characteristics face, identify orientation and determine position etc..When conventional compass measures trend, inclination angle, Amass little with intrusion contact surface, easily big by magnetic disturbance, measurement error.In addition compass in use there is also The not problem of drop resistant, function singleness.It is thus desirable to develop a kind of portable circumferentor, solve prior art The measurement error of middle circumferentor is big and the problem of function singleness.
Utility model content
This utility model, for the deficiencies in the prior art, provides a kind of portable circumferentor and solves existing skill In art, the measurement error of circumferentor is big and the problem of function singleness, and convenient and practical.
The technical solution of the utility model is achieved in that a kind of portable circumferentor includes passing through hinge Being hinged on down the upper cover covered, above cover and be provided with illuminator and short rearsight, lower cover top is provided with graduated disc, Described graduated disc is provided with compass needle in the middle of it, and compass needle side is respectively equipped with circular bubble, and lower cover passes through Hinge is hinged with long rearsight, it is characterised in that compass needle side is provided with goniometer;Described compass needle It is provided with one layer of self-luminescent material layer with dial surface;Described lower cover bottom outside coupling is socketed with vibration isolation rubber Set;Cover under described and be provided with magnetic declination set screw.
Described compass needle uses fluid damping structure.
Described self-luminescent material layer is strontium aluminate dope layer.
Described upper cover and lower cover use aluminium alloy casting to form.
Cover under described and be provided with magnetic needle switch.
Described graduated disc inwall is provided with the circle LED for illumination.
Described lower cover side is additionally provided with lanyard.
This utility model solves defect present in background technology, has the advantages that
The portable circumferentor dependable performance that this utility model provides, solves circumferentor in prior art Measurement error is big and the problem of function singleness, and convenient and practical.When night or marginal ray deficiency, compass The self-luminescent material layer of magnetic needle and dial surface is luminous, helps geological personnel to see reading clearly.Compass needle is adopted Use fluid damping structure, this fluid damping structure, positioning time is short, and anti-magnetic disturbance, measurement error is little. The magnetic needle switch arranged, the position of lockable compass needle, make total indicator reading accurately and reliably.The angle measurement arranged Device can measure the inclination angle of rock stratum.Lower cover bottom outside coupling is socketed with vibration isolation rubber and is enclosed within when compass is dropped, Vibration-absorbing rubber sleeve can reduce vibration, plays cushioning effect.

The portable circumferentor of one as shown in Figure 1, including the upper cover 1 being hinged on lower cover 5 by hinge, Upper cover 1 is provided with illuminator 2 and short rearsight 10, and lower cover 5 top is provided with graduated disc 3.Graduated disc 3 its Centre is provided with compass needle 8, and compass needle 8 side is respectively equipped with circular bubble 9, and lower cover 5 is cut with scissors by hinge Being connected to long rearsight 6, compass needle 8 side is provided with goniometer 4;Compass needle 8 and graduated disc 3 surface set Having one layer of self-luminescent material layer, this self-luminescent material layer is preferably strontium aluminate dope layer, and fluorescent lifetime is long.When When night or marginal ray deficiency, the self-luminescent material layer on compass needle 8 and graduated disc 3 surface is luminous, side Geological personnel is helped to see reading clearly.Lower cover 5 bottom outside coupling is socketed with vibration-absorbing rubber sleeve 11, when compass is dropped Time, vibration-absorbing rubber sleeve 11 can reduce vibration, play cushioning effect.Lower cover 5 is provided with magnetic declination regulation spiral shell Silk 12, adjustable magnetic declination plays debugging functions.Owing to fluctuating in magnetic field of the earth, magnetic declination can be the slowest Change, magnetic declination can be calibrated according to location, be adjusted with screwdriver.Compass needle 8 uses liquid Body damping structure, this fluid damping structure, positioning time is short, and anti-magnetic disturbance, measurement error is little.On Lid 1 and lower cover 5 use aluminium alloy casting to form.Lower cover 5 is provided with magnetic needle switch 7, lockable compass needle The position of 8, makes total indicator reading accurately and reliably.Described graduated disc 3 inwall is provided with the circle LED for illumination Light bar.Described lower cover 5 side is additionally provided with lanyard, easy to carry.
Work process of the present utility model is: when survey is moved towards, and opens upper cover 1 and arrives extreme position, uses magnetic declination Set screw 12 mixes up the magnetic declination of this area, and upper cover 1 and the long limit of lower cover 5 lean against the characteristic face of rock stratum, The blister keeping circular bubble 9 is placed in the middle, and compass needle 8 reading is formation strike.When surveying tendency, use Covering 1 back side characteristic face by steady rock, the blister keeping circular bubble 9 is placed in the middle, and compass needle 8 reading is i.e. It is inclined to for rock stratum.When surveying inclination angle, upper cover 1 and lower cover 5 side are perpendicular to trend and are adjacent to the feature of rock stratum Face, the blister keeping circular bubble 9 is placed in the middle, and the reading of the goniometer 4 that indicator refers to is the inclination angle of rock stratum. When night or insufficient light, the self-luminescent material layer on compass needle 8 and graduated disc 3 surface is luminous, helps Geological personnel sees reading clearly.
